Frank Hernandez

Frank "Slick" Hernandez, 66 of Belton, died May 29 at his home. Funeral services were at 2 p.m. June 1 at Dossman Funeral Home with Pastor Rick Reed and Bro. Chuck Hernandez officiating.

Mr. Hernandez was born in Georgetown Aug. 18, 1945 to Nieves Hernandez and Francis (Torres) Hernndez. He worked as an electrician and spent his free time coaching fore the Central Texas Youth Football League.

He was preceded in death by his parents, two daughters, Marilyn Hernandez and Amanda Gonzalez and two brothers.

He is survived by his companion, Teresa Jones; five sons, James Hernandez, Jason Hernandez, Alvin Alexander, Benton Morgan, Michael Jones; four daughters, Theresa Hernandez Copeland, Gina Hernandez and Candy Hernandez; one brother, Chuck Hernandez; two sister, Marie Hernandez, Linda Hernandez Yost, 29 grandchildren and numerous great-grandchildren.

Dossman Funeral Home was in charge of arrangements.
